Spikey2005   Posted 4th Nov 2005 2:24am
L4Y Member
Post 89 / 2126

Im also on a Local Area Network the same as you. Port numbers, is a number thats given to an application so that it can be found by others using the same application like Red Faction for example. Port numbers are usually 4 or 5 digits long. (IP - x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x: Port numbers after IP xxxxx)

What you need to do is to access your LAN settings by typing in your LAN IP address (192.168.1.1 is the default) into your Internet Broswer. You need to go through additional setups but I would recommend that you phone up your LAN Company for Techincal assistance for "Port Forwarding".

If you mess up your settings, you might not be able to access the internet again. So please be careful what you modify.

How to find your server's IP

Quoting NoClanFrank
OK if you haven't figured it out already this is how:

1. Go here: whatismyip.com.
2. Copy that IP address, which is your IP address.
3. Now to the IP address that you have just added, add this to it: :7755, assuming that you haven't changed the default port on which Red Faction works on when creating a server.
4. Start your game.
5. Click join.
6. Click the LAN TAB.
7. Click add a server.
8. Add the IP address plus the port 7755 (example 71.105.74.210:7755 which is my IP address for the server when I run one).
9. You should now have a favorite added to you list, if you don't see it or it shows it as N/R then you are behind a firewall wall or you have not forward a port on your router.
10. If you need to forward a port on your router then I recommend you find your router on this page and read how to configure it:
Portforward.com
You will also fine some useful information on firewalls on this page as well.
11. If you use Windows XP then it also might be a firewall issue then you might want to read do this:

Q. How do I enable or disable the Windows XP Internet Connection Firewall?

A. Click Start, Control Panel, double–click Network Connections, right-click the desired connection, Properties, Advanced tab, Under Internet Connection Firewall, un-check or check the Protect my computer and network by limiting or preventing access to this computer from the Internet check box.

skvlad01   Posted 4th Nov 2005 12:20pm
L4Y Member
Post 88 / 614

you have to put the ip of your modem not you network card.
your ip was 192.168.0.100:7755. which looks like a net work ip coz my network ip is 192.168.0.1 almost the same as yours. but my internet ip is 220.235.210.4:7755. and thats the ip u need to give them and if you are on dial up that ip changes every time u dial up. u can find that ip by clicking on the dial up symbol in the tray and then click on the details tab, then look for client ip and then add 7755 to the end and there u go u will have a red faction server address
